Nomura, Asia’s global investment bank, today launched the
“Nomura Nikkei 225 Euro-Hedged UCITS Exchange Traded Fund” and the “Nomura Nikkei
225 US Dollar-Hedged UCITS Exchange Traded Fund”. The ETFs are listed on the London
Stock Exchange and will be available to investors in key European markets.
The investment objective of the funds is to track the performance of the recently launched
Nikkei 225 Total Return US Dollar and Euro-hedged indices, which reference the most liquid
equities traded on the Tokyo Stock Exchange.
Offering the ETFs in US Dollar and Eurohedged
formats will allow investors to gain exposure to Japanese equities, while reducing
the impact of exchange rate fluctuations.
The ETFs are part of Nomura’s NEXT FUNDS range, which offer physical replication of
benchmark indices in various asset classes. Today’s launch marks the first time NEXT
FUNDS will be distributed outside Japan and in UCITS format. The launch is the result of
collaboration by Nomura Asset Management (“NAM”) and Nomura Alternative Investment
Management Europe (“NAIM”).
NAM is the largest asset management company in Japan,
with assets under management in excess of US$300 billion (as of September 30, 2014).
NAIM is an investment management company within the Nomura group.
